在網頁中,我們常常需要對某些字體進行移動的效果,來吸引用戶的注意力或者增加頁面的藝術效果。使用Vue來實現字體移動的功能,可以快捷、簡單地滿足我們的需求。
// 引入Vue
import Vue from 'vue'
// 創建Vue實例
new Vue({
//el為動態綁定的DOM元素
el: '#app',
//data為數據,可在模板中使用
data: {
// 定義初始位置
posX: 0,
posY: 0,
},
//methods為方法
methods: {
// 移動字體的方法
moveFont () {
// 根據Math.random()來隨機生成坐標變化
let x = Math.random() * 500px
let y = Math.random() * 500px
// 更新數據
this.posX = x
this.posY = y
}
}
})
使用Vue的好處在于可以利用它的兼容性、響應式以及高效性等特性,來使移動字體的功能更加靈活和優雅。我們可以利用data來定義字體的位置,使用methods來定義移動的方法,最后再將數據和方法綁定到相應的DOM元素上。
// 在模板中綁定位置和字體樣式Vue字體移動
最后再通過模板來將數據和方法渲染到頁面上,同時實現字體移動的效果。其中,我們綁定了字體位置、樣式以及點擊動作,將它們綁定到一個p標簽上,這樣當我們點擊文字時,字體位置就會更新并且隨機移動。
總之,Vue作為一款現代的JavaScript框架,可以直接在HTML中引用,使用模板來定義渲染的內容,數據與視圖之間通過雙向綁定的方式實現實時更新,以及快速處理大部分常見問題,如DOM操作、事件監聽、模塊化等。因此,在實現字體移動等功能時,Vue的優勢得到了充分的發揮,使得實現更加方便、可靠、高效。
下一篇mysql刪除表主鍵